Wood Window Service involves a range of repair, restoration, and replacement options designed to maintain or improve the functionality and appearance of wooden windows. These services typically include fixing damaged or rotting wood, restoring old or weathered frames, and installing new wooden windows when necessary. Skilled professionals assess the condition of existing wood components, addressing issues such as cracked sashes, warped frames, or deteriorated paint, to enhance the window’s performance and aesthetic appeal.
This service helps resolve common problems associated with wooden windows, such as drafts, difficulty opening or closing, and water leaks.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ause wood to swell, rot, or decay, leading to reduced energy efficiency and potential structural concerns. Wood window specialists can also assist with restoring historic or vintage windows to preserve their original charm while ensuring they meet current standards for insulation and security.

Replacement Costs - Replacing a wood window can range from $300 to $800 per window, depending on size and style. Custom or larger windows may cost more, with prices reaching up to $1,200 each in some cases.
Repair Expenses - Repairing wood windows typically costs between $150 and $400 per window. Common repairs include rotted wood, broken glass, or hardware replacement, which influence the overall cost.
Refinishing and Painting - Refinishing or repainting wood windows generally falls within the $100 to $300 range per window. This includes sanding, priming, and painting to restore appearance and protect the wood.
Installation Fees - Professional installation of wood windows can cost between $200 and $600 per window. Costs vary based on window size, complexity, and local labor rates in Owings, MD area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
